Why Insulation Matters for Your Garage Door Your garage door is essentially one of the largest entry points to your home. Without proper insulation, it can act as a massive thermal bridge, allowing heat to flow in during the summer and escape in the winter. This can make it harder for your HVAC system to regulate the temperature inside your home, especially if you have an attached garage. An insulated garage door acts as a barrier, reducing the transfer of heat or cold air between your garage and the rest of your home. This improved thermal efficiency translates into savings on your energy bills. Top 10 Signs Your Garage Door Needs Repair
Your garage door is one of the most frequently used entry points to your home, and over time, wear and tear can take its toll. Ignoring early signs of trouble can lead to more significant issues and costly repairs. Here are the top signs that your garage door may need professional attention. 1. Unusual Noises What to Listen For: Grinding, squeaking, or banging sounds when the door is in operation. Potential Issues: Noises could indicate problems with the springs, rollers, or tracks. A well-maintained garage door should operate relatively quietly. 2. Slow Response Time What to Watch For: A noticeable delay between pressing the opener and the door starting to move. Potential Issues: This could be due to problems with the opener, worn-out springs, or other mechanical issues that need attention. 3. Door Doesn’t Open or Close Fully What to Check: If the door stops midway or doesn’t close fully. Potential Issues: This might be due to misaligned sensors, a malfunctioning opener, or issues with the door’s balance. 4. Sagging Door Sections What to Notice: Uneven sections of the door when it’s closed. Potential Issues: This could indicate balance issues or structural damage. Regular maintenance checks can prevent this problem from worsening. 5. Vibrating or Shaking Door What to Observe: Excessive vibration or shaking when the door is moving. Potential Issues: This can be a sign of loose hardware, worn-out rollers, or a problem with the tracks. 6. The Door is Off Its Tracks What to Notice: The door doesn’t move smoothly along the tracks or appears misaligned. Potential Issues: This can be a safety hazard and may result from physical damage, wear and tear, or an accident. Immediate attention is required to prevent further damage. 7. Broken or Worn Springs What to Look For: Visible wear, gaps in the coils, or a complete break. Potential Issues: Springs bear much of the door’s weight. Broken springs can make the door difficult to operate and pose a safety risk. 8. Increased Energy Bills What to Monitor: A sudden increase in energy costs. Potential Issues: Poor insulation or gaps in the garage door can lead to energy loss. Upgrading to an insulated door can improve energy efficiency. 9. Door Reverses Before Closing What to Notice: The door starts to close but reverses before touching the ground. Potential Issues: Misaligned or dirty sensors, or an obstruction in the door’s path, can cause this issue. 10. Remote or Wall Switch Malfunctions What to Check: Delayed response or no response from your remote or wall switch. Potential Issues: This could be due to dead batteries, signal interference, or a problem with the opener itself. Comparing Different Garage Door Materials for Energy Efficiency
When it comes to selecting a garage door, homeowners often focus on aesthetics, security, and durability. However, energy efficiency is another crucial factor that can significantly impact your home’s overall insulation and energy consumption. The material of your garage door plays a key role in its energy efficiency, influencing everything from insulation to heat retention. In this blog, we’ll compare different garage door materials to help you make an informed decision that balances both style and energy efficiency. 1. Steel Garage Doors Pros: Durability: Steel is one of the most durable materials available for garage doors, offering excellent protection against weather and physical damage. Insulation Options: Steel doors can be insulated with polyurethane or polystyrene, making them highly energy-efficient. Insulated steel doors typically have a high R-value, indicating superior thermal resistance. Cons: Heat Conductivity: While steel is strong, it is also a good conductor of heat. Without proper insulation, a steel door can allow heat to escape in the winter and enter during the summer, reducing energy efficiency. Rust Risk: In humid climates, steel doors may be prone to rusting, although modern steel doors often come with rust-resistant coatings. Energy Efficiency Rating: ★★★★☆ Conclusion: Insulated steel doors are a great option for homeowners looking for a durable and energy-efficient solution. Ensure your steel door is properly insulated to maximize its energy efficiency. 2. Wood Garage Doors Pros: Aesthetic Appeal: Wood doors are prized for their natural beauty and can be customized to match the style of your home. Insulation Capability: Wood is a naturally insulating material, providing moderate energy efficiency. Thicker wood doors offer better insulation. Cons: Maintenance: Wood doors require regular maintenance, including sealing, staining, or painting, to protect against moisture and temperature fluctuations. Weight: Wood doors are heavier than other materials, which may require a more powerful opener and add strain to the garage door system. Energy Efficiency Rating: ★★★☆☆ Conclusion: While wood doors offer natural insulation and aesthetic appeal, they may not be the best choice for energy efficiency, especially in extreme climates. Regular maintenance is also necessary to maintain their efficiency. 3. Aluminum Garage Doors Pros: Lightweight: Aluminum doors are lightweight, reducing the strain on the garage door opener and other components. Rust-Resistant: Aluminum is naturally rust-resistant, making it a good choice for humid or coastal environments. Cons: Poor Insulation: Aluminum is not a good insulator and has low thermal resistance. Without insulation, aluminum doors are among the least energy-efficient options. Dents Easily: Aluminum is a softer metal, which makes it more prone to dents and damage. Energy Efficiency Rating: ★★☆☆☆ Conclusion: Aluminum garage doors are lightweight and rust-resistant but lack the insulation needed for high energy efficiency. Consider insulated models if energy efficiency is a priority. 4. Fiberglass Garage Doors Pros: Lightweight and Durable: Fiberglass doors are lightweight and resistant to dents, corrosion, and rust. They are also low-maintenance. Customization: Fiberglass can be designed to mimic the look of wood without the same level of upkeep. Cons: Insulation Variability: Fiberglass by itself doesn’t provide much insulation. However, fiberglass doors can be paired with foam insulation to improve energy efficiency. Susceptibility to Fading: Fiberglass can fade or become brittle when exposed to extreme sunlight over time. Energy Efficiency Rating: ★★★☆☆ Conclusion: Fiberglass doors are a good compromise between durability and energy efficiency, especially when paired with proper insulation. However, they may require additional protection from sun exposure in hot climates. 5. Vinyl Garage Doors Pros: Highly Durable: Vinyl is resistant to dents, rust, and weathering, making it a durable and low-maintenance option. Good Insulation: Vinyl doors often come with built-in insulation, providing good energy efficiency and thermal resistance. Cons: Fewer Design Options: Vinyl doors typically offer fewer design and color options compared to wood or steel. Color Fading: Prolonged exposure to sunlight can cause vinyl to fade over time. Energy Efficiency Rating: ★★★★☆ Conclusion: Vinyl garage doors are a solid choice for energy efficiency, especially in areas with extreme weather. They offer good insulation and durability with minimal maintenance. 6. Composite Garage Doors Pros: Energy Efficient: Composite doors are made from a mix of materials, often including wood fibers and synthetic materials, offering excellent insulation. Low Maintenance: These doors provide the look of wood with less maintenance, resisting rot and insect damage. Cons: Cost: Composite doors can be more expensive than other materials due to their construction and insulation properties. Energy Efficiency Rating: ★★★★★ Conclusion: Composite garage doors are among the most energy-efficient options available. They combine the aesthetic appeal of wood with the durability and insulation of synthetic materials, making them an excellent choice for energy-conscious homeowners. Conclusion When it comes to energy efficiency, the material of your garage door plays a significant role. Insulated steel, vinyl, and composite doors offer the best energy efficiency, making them ideal for homeowners looking to reduce their energy costs. Wood and fiberglass doors can also be good options, depending on your climate and maintenance preferences. By choosing the right material for your garage door, you can enhance your home’s energy efficiency, comfort, and overall value. Understanding the Las Vegas Climate Impact Las Vegas is known for its extreme temperatures, with scorching summers and mild winters. The intense heat can cause wear and tear on your garage door’s components, particularly the springs, cables, and rollers. Over time, these parts can weaken, leading to malfunctions that require expensive repairs if not addressed early. The dry climate can also cause wooden doors to warp and metal parts to rust, compromising the door’s functionality. Inspect Your Garage Door Before the Weekend Before the long weekend begins, take a few minutes to visually inspect your garage door. Look for any signs of wear and tear, such as frayed cables, rusted parts, or loose hardware. Pay special attention to the rollers, springs, and tracks, as these components are critical to the door’s smooth operation. If you notice anything unusual, it’s best to address the issue right away to prevent it from becoming a bigger problem during the holiday. 2. Test the Auto-Reverse Function The auto-reverse function is a key safety feature of your garage door. This mechanism causes the door to automatically reverse direction if it encounters an obstruction while closing, preventing accidents and injuries. To test this feature, place an object, such as a block of wood, in the door’s path and attempt to close the door. If the door does not reverse immediately upon contact with the object, you may need to adjust the sensitivity or call a professional for repairs. 3. Check the Balance of Your Garage Door A properly balanced garage door is essential for safe operation. If the door is out of balance, it can put undue strain on the opener and other components, leading to potential failures. To check the balance, disconnect the opener and manually lift the door halfway. If it stays in place, it’s properly balanced. If it falls or rises on its own, the door is out of balance and should be adjusted by a professional. 4. Secure the Garage Door Remote During holiday weekends, it’s common for families to be in and out of the house, making it easy to misplace items like garage door remotes. To prevent unauthorized access to your home, make sure your remote is stored securely, especially if you’re hosting guests or planning to leave town. Consider using a keychain remote or a smart garage door opener that can be controlled via your smartphone for added security. 5. Educate Family Members on Garage Door Safety If you have children or guests who aren’t familiar with your garage door, take a moment to educate them on basic safety rules. Remind everyone not to walk or stand under the door while it’s in motion and to keep fingers and other objects away from the door’s moving parts. It’s also a good idea to explain how to operate the emergency release in case of a power outage or other issues. 6. Lubricate Moving Parts To ensure smooth and quiet operation, lubricate the moving parts of your garage door, including the rollers, hinges, and springs. Use a high-quality silicone-based lubricant designed for garage doors. Proper lubrication not only reduces noise but also helps prevent wear and tear, extending the lifespan of your door. 7. Schedule a Professional Inspection If it’s been a while since your last professional garage door inspection, Labor Day is a great time to schedule one. A trained technician can identify potential issues that may not be apparent during a DIY inspection, ensuring that your door is safe and ready for the long weekend. Regular professional maintenance can help prevent costly repairs down the road and give you peace of mind. 8. Secure the Garage Door While Traveling If you’re planning to travel over the Labor Day weekend, take extra precautions to secure your garage door. Unplug the garage door opener to prevent it from being operated by a remote, and consider using a manual lock to secure the door. If you have a smart garage door opener, you can monitor and control your door remotely, providing an additional layer of security while you’re away. Top 5 Garage Door Repair Issues in Las Vegas and How to Fix Them
Garage doors are essential to our homes, providing security, convenience, and enhancing curb appeal. However, like any mechanical system, they can experience issues over time, especially in the unique climate of Las Vegas. Here are the top five garage door repair issues commonly faced by Las Vegas homeowners and some tips on fixing them. 1. Broken Springs Issue: Garage door springs do the heavy lifting each time you open or close the door. Over time, they can wear out and break, leaving your garage door inoperable or difficult to lift manually. How to Fix: It’s crucial not to attempt to replace the springs yourself due to their high tension, which can cause serious injury. Instead, contact a professional garage door technician to replace the broken springs safely. Regular maintenance checks can help identify worn-out springs before they break. 2. Misaligned Tracks Issue: The tracks guide the garage door smoothly up and down. If they become misaligned, the door may not open or close correctly, and you might hear grinding or squeaking noises. How to Fix: Inspect the tracks for gaps between the rollers and rail, bends, or misalignment. If you notice any issues, loosen the screws that hold the tracks in place and gently tap them back into the correct position. Ensure they are level using a spirit level before tightening the screws. For significant misalignment or damage, it’s best to call a professional. 3. Worn or Broken Rollers Issue: Rollers ensure the smooth movement of the garage door along the tracks. Over time, they can become worn or break, causing the door to get stuck or operate noisily. How to Fix: Regularly inspect the rollers for signs of wear and tear. Lubricate them with a silicone-based lubricant to reduce friction. If the rollers are damaged, they will need to be replaced. If you are comfortable working with tools, this can be a DIY task, but a professional should handle the replacement for those not confident in their repair skills. 4. Faulty Garage Door Opener Issue: The garage door opener is the motorized component that operates the door. Problems such as the door not responding to the remote or wall switch or the motor running without the door moving can arise. How to Fix: First, check the power source and ensure the opener is plugged in and the circuit breaker is not tripped. Replace the batteries in the remote control. If the issue persists, inspect the opener’s wiring and sensors. Misaligned or obstructed sensors can prevent the door from closing. Clean the sensor lenses and realign them if necessary. Consult a professional technician for more complex issues, such as motor failure. 5. Noisy Garage Door Issue: A noisy garage door can be more than just an annoyance; it can indicate underlying problems such as loose hardware, worn rollers, or lack of lubrication. How to Fix: Tighten all nuts and bolts on the door and track system. Using a garage door lubricant, lubricate all moving parts, including the rollers, hinges, and tracks. Avoid using WD-40 as it is not designed for this purpose. If the noise persists, inspect the door for worn parts that need replacing. Conclusion Regular maintenance and timely repairs ensure your garage door functions smoothly and lasts longer. While some minor issues can be tackled with a DIY approach, it’s essential to know when to seek professional help to avoid potential injury and further damage. By promptly addressing these common repair issues, Las Vegas homeowners can keep their garage doors in top shape, providing reliability and peace of mind. Types of Garage Door Service Warranties Installation Warranty: Covers the quality of the installation work performed by the service provider. If any issues arise due to improper installation, they will be corrected at no additional cost. Repair Warranty: This warranty applies to specific repairs performed on the garage door or opener. It ensures that the repair work is reliable and that the parts used are of good quality. Maintenance Warranty: Some companies offer warranties on regular maintenance services. This type of warranty guarantees that the maintenance work will be performed to a high standard and that any issues identified during the service will be addressed. Key Components of a Garage Door Service Warranty When evaluating service warranties, consider the following components to ensure you understand the coverage: Duration: The length of the warranty can vary widely. Installation warranties often last one to two years, while repair warranties might range from 30 days to a year. Maintenance warranties usually cover the period between scheduled services. Scope of Coverage: Understand exactly what is covered under the warranty. For example, an installation warranty might cover issues related to the fitting and alignment of the door, while a repair warranty might only cover the part replaced. Exclusions: Warranties often exclude certain types of damage or conditions. For instance, damage caused by improper use, accidents, or natural disasters might not be covered. Be sure to read the fine print to know what is excluded. Claim Process: Understand the steps required to make a warranty claim. This usually involves contacting the service provider, providing proof of service, and describing the issue in detail.
